随着云计算的普及和快速发展,容器化技术在云计算领域中的地位日益突出。Kubernetes,作为一个开源的容器编排系统,因其高效、灵活、可扩展等特性,已成为许多企业进行容器化部署和管理的首选。本文将详细介绍如何在阿里云服务器上部署和管理Kubernetes。
部署Kubernetes:
首先,你需要在阿里云服务器上安装并配置好所需的软件环境,如Java、Docker等。你可以通过阿里云提供的一键安装包来快速完成这些步骤。
然后,你需要在阿里云服务器上下载并安装Kubernetes的最新版本。你可以在官方网站上找到相关的下载链接和安装指南。
安装完成后,你需要创建一个Kubernetes集群。这可以通过使用kubectl命令行工具来完成。你需要在集群中配置至少一个Master节点和一个Worker节点。
最后,你需要将你的应用程序容器化,并通过Docker镜像推送到Kubernetes的仓库中。你也可以使用Kubernetes的部署和滚动更新功能,来快速地部署和更新你的应用程序。
管理Kubernetes:
Kubectl命令行工具是管理Kubernetes的主要工具。你可以使用kubectl命令来查看和操作你的Kubernetes集群中的各种资源,如Pods、Services、Deployments等。
Kubernetes的监控和日志管理功能也非常强大。你可以使用Kubernetes的metrics-server组件,来监控你的Kubernetes集群的运行状态。你也可以使用Kubernetes的logging-component,来收集和处理你的应用程序的日志信息。
Kubernetes的版本管理功能也很重要。你可以在Kubernetes的控制台上,查看和管理你的Kubernetes集群的各个版本。你可以使用Kubernetes的kubectl apply命令,来更新你的Kubernetes集群的各个版本。
总的来说,Kubernetes在阿里云服务器上的部署和管理,需要你具备一定的云计算和容器化技术知识。但是,通过阿里云提供的各种资源和支持,你可以快速地学习和掌握这些知识。